Output 899521cabe82ac42de75774f3734cba0b34faaa6a074f9905547830e25f7d4b3:0

value
1079278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6cde4f167fd2a90e0d42c733485bbdf117218d OP_EQUAL
address
MHhAxGJfgFvfs7chb1mDjaR4xVPxqbahEs
transaction
899521cabe82ac42de75774f3734cba0b34faaa6a074f9905547830e25f7d4b3
spent
true